Traffic regulations will be applied on Sunday 9/4 in the center of Athens due to the running of the street race with the brand “6th Areos Field Competition “In the neighborhoods of Athens”.

Specifically from 08.00 to 11.00there will be a temporary stop to traffic and a ban on stopping and parking vehicles, on the following streets:

-Mavrommataion,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

– Euelpidon,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-Mustoxydis,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

– Valtinon,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

– Bousgou,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-L. Alexandras, in the section between Ippokratous and Mavrommataia streets, in the flow of traffic towards Patision street, in the right traffic lane and on the right side of it up to the first parallel street.

– Princes’ Islands,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-Aglaofontos,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

– Megaloupoleos,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

– Pl. Gyzi,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-Gyzi,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-Momferatou,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

– Boukouvala,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-Lombardou,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

-Barvaki, along its entire length and on its diagonals up to the first parallel street.

“The drivers of the vehicles are requested, in order to serve them better and to prevent traffic accidents, to be particularly careful when passing through the above points and to follow the existing road markings and the instructions of the traffic wardens”, the relevant police announcement states.
